Transaction 851277a3ef7516034f6c54ca55fab69402aca1f1738d6e57b1b90589aa3c5531
1 Input
1 Output
-
851277a3ef7516034f6c54ca55fab69402aca1f1738d6e57b1b90589aa3c5531:0
- value
- 1899988
- script pubkey
- OP_0 OP_PUSHBYTES_20 531f24cb6062a36343bd4fe94c49a33499e01c13
- address
- ltc1q2v0jfjmqv23kxsaafl55cjdrxjv7q8qnqnr8pm